Grade 8 Science builds on earlier grades by introducing deeper scientific concepts and hands‑on investigations. Students explore:
How cells form systems in living organisms
How fluids behave and why they matter in technology
How light travels, reflects, refracts, and forms images
How mechanical systems use forces, energy, and machines
How water systems shape Earth and support life
How Earth fits into the universe
Students learn to:
Use scientific models
Analyze and interpret data
Build and test prototypes
Communicate scientific ideas
Connect science to everyday life

⭐ INTRODUCTION Chemistry 20 explores how matter behaves, how atoms bond, how reactions occur, and how energy flows through chemical systems. Students learn the foundational concepts needed for Chemistry 30, university chemistry, and real‑world applications in medicine, engineering, and environmental science.
⚡ PHYSICS 20 — INTRODUCTION Physics 20 explores the fundamental principles that govern motion, forces, energy, and momentum. Students learn how objects move, why they move, and how energy flows through physical systems. Through real‑world applications, hands‑on problem solving, and clear conceptual models, learners build a strong foundation for advanced physics, engineering, and STEM pathways. This course emphasizes critical thinking, mathematical reasoning, and scientific inquiry while connecting physics concepts to everyday life.
Introduction — Biology 20 Biology 20 explores how living systems obtain, use, and transfer energy. Students investigate human physiology, ecological relationships, photosynthesis, cellular respiration, and population dynamics. This course builds the scientific reasoning and analytical skills needed for Biology 30.
